Increasing US-China tensions push gold price up

The price of gold rose by Bt150 per baht weight in morning trade on Thursday (July 23), the Gold Traders Association reported.

As of 9.30am, the buying price of a gold bar was Bt27,750 per baht weight and selling price Bt27,850, while gold ornaments cost Bt27,257.68 and Bt28,350, respectively.

At close on Wednesday (July 22), the buying price of a gold bar was Bt27,600 per baht weight and selling price Bt27,700, while gold ornaments cost Bt27,106.08 and Bt28,200, respectively.

The COMEX (Commodity Exchange) gold price to be delivered in August rose by US$21.2, or 1.15 per cent, to US$1,865.1 (Bt58,986) per ounce at close on Wednesday, the highest since September 2011.

Uncertainty following tensions between the US and China and the weakening dollar have caused investors to buy gold as a safe-haven asset.

Chinese Gold and Silver Exchange Society said that Hong Kong gold price rose by HK$200, opening at $17,320 (US$2,234.40 or Bt70,748) per tael Thursday morning.
